Training Overview

Pelvic Congestion Syndrome & Varicocele Embolization Masterclass is a focused, simulation-based educational program designed to strengthen clinical decision-making and technical proficiency in transcatheter endovascular treatment of pelvic venous disorders and male varicoceles. This one-day intensive training combines pelvic and gonadal venous anatomy, patient selection criteria, case-based learning, and high-fidelity simulations to support safe, effective, and minimally invasive venous embolization therapies.

The program begins with essential modules on pelvic venous hemodynamics, reflux patterns, and multi-modality imaging interpretation (Duplex Ultrasound, CT/MR Venography, and Catheter Venography). Participants review diagnostic criteria for Pelvic Congestion Syndrome (PCS) and male varicocele, pain mapping, and gain a structured approach to identifying underlying compressive syndromes—such as May-Thurner or Nutcracker phenomena—in daily practice.

Simulation-based sessions focus on retrograde catheterization of internal iliac and gonadal (ovarian/testicular) veins, microcatheter navigation through tortuous venous tributaries, and real-time fluoroscopic roadmapping. Intensive hands-on workshops cover the selection, sizing, and deployment of diverse embolic tools, including mechanical devices (pushable/detachable coils and vascular plugs) and sclerosants/foam agents.

Advanced case discussions address challenging clinical scenarios, such as recurrent varicoceles, complex collateral venous networks, persistent post-embolization pain, and high-risk outflow variations. Integrated simulations emphasize crisis management for acute intraprocedural complications, including coil migration, vein wall perforation, non-target sclerosant flow, and vasospasm.

By the end of this intensive program, participants will be able to confidently select appropriate embolic strategies, navigate complex pelvic venous pathways, and execute embolization procedures safely while effectively preventing and managing potential complications.
